Overview
Lateral movement in Azure AD/Entra ID differs from on-premises environments. Attackers pivot through OAuth application consent grants, service principal abuse, cross-tenant access policies, and stolen refresh tokens rather than SMB/RDP connections. Detection requires correlating Microsoft Graph API audit logs, Azure AD sign-in logs, and Entra ID protection risk events using KQL queries in Microsoft Sentinel. This skill covers building detection analytics for common Azure lateral movement techniques including application impersonation, mailbox delegation abuse, and conditional access policy bypasses.

Steps
Step 1: Configure Log Ingestion
Enable diagnostic settings to stream Azure AD logs to Log Analytics:
- Sign-in logs (interactive and non-interactive)
- Audit logs (directory changes, app consent)
- Service principal sign-in logs
- Provisioning logs
- Risky users and risk detections
Step 2: Build Detection Queries
Create KQL analytics rules in Sentinel for:
- Unusual service principal credential additions
- OAuth application consent grants to unknown apps
- Cross-tenant sign-ins from new tenants
- Token replay from different IP/user-agent combinations
- Mailbox delegation changes (FullAccess, SendAs)
Step 3: Correlate Events
Chain multiple low-confidence indicators into high-confidence lateral movement detections by correlating sign-in anomalies with directory changes within time windows.
Step 4: Automate Response
Create Sentinel playbooks (Logic Apps) to automatically revoke suspicious OAuth grants, disable compromised service principals, and enforce step-up authentication.

-d "scope=https://graph.microsoft.com/.default"Sentinel KQL - Lateral Movement Detections
OAuth Consent Grant (T1550.001)
AuditLogs
| where OperationName == "Consent to application"
| extend InitiatedBy = tostring(InitiatedBy.user.userPrincipalName)
| extend AppName = tostring(TargetResources[0].displayName)
| project TimeGenerated, InitiatedBy, AppName, ResultService Principal Credential Addition (T1098.001)
AuditLogs
| where OperationName has_any ("Add service principal credentials", "Update application")
| extend Actor = tostring(InitiatedBy.user.userPrincipalName)
| extend Target = tostring(TargetResources[0].displayName)
| project TimeGenerated, Actor, Target, OperationNameToken Replay Detection (T1528)
SigninLogs
| summarize IPCount=dcount(IPAddress), IPs=make_set(IPAddress) by UserPrincipalName, bin(TimeGenerated, 1h)
| where IPCount >= 5
| sort by IPCount descCross-Tenant Access (T1078.004)
SigninLogs
| where ResourceTenantId != HomeTenantId
| project TimeGenerated, UserPrincipalName, IPAddress, ResourceTenantId, AppDisplayNameRequired Graph API Permissions

MITRE ATT&CK Azure Techniques
| Technique | ID | Azure Indicator |
|---|---|---|
| Application Access Token | T1550.001 | OAuth consent grant |
| Account Manipulation | T1098.001 | SP credential addition |
| Cloud Accounts | T1078.004 | Cross-tenant sign-in |
| Steal Application Access Token | T1528 | Token from multiple IPs |
